Google Authenticator supports exporting up to 10 accounts at one time. Then use Import QR Image Backup to import the accounts. Take a screenshot to save the QR image (iPhone), or take a picture with another phone/camera (Android). Choose the account information you wish to transfer from the list. In Google Authenticator, tap on the three dots in the upper right-hand corner of the screen. You can also import Google Authenticator accounts. You can select multiple images to import more than one account at a time.
